How Our Team Removes Water from Your Windows

When water starts seeping into your home, every minute counts. That’s why our team is equipped to respond quickly, with a comprehensive process that ensures your property is restored to its former glory. Here’s what you can expect:

Step 1: Assessment and Planning

We’ll arrive on-site, assess the damage, and create a customized plan to remove water and repair any affected areas. Our team will use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ture and pinpoint the source of the leak.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We’ll use industrial-grade pumps and vacuums to extract water from your home, reducing the risk of further damage. Our team will work efficiently to remove standing water, wet carpets, and saturated drywall.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

We’ll employ advanced drying techniques to remove excess moisture from your home, including the use of high-velocity air movers and dehumidifiers. This step is crucial in preventing mold growth and secondary damage.

Step 4: Repair and Restoration

Once the water is removed and the area is dry, our team will repair any damaged walls, floors, and ceilings. We’ll work with you to select materials that match your home’s original style and ensure a seamless finish.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leanup

We’ll conduct a thorough inspection to ensure your home is safe and dry. Our team will leave your property clean, organized, and ready for you to move back in.

Warning Signs You Need Window Leak Water Removal

Don’t ignore these common warning signs, which can show a more serious issue: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ant smells can be a sign of hidden moisture and potential mold growth. If you notice a persistent musty odor, it’s time to call us.

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ls

Discoloration or water spots on your walls or ceilings can show a leak or water damage. Don’t delay, address the issue before it becomes a bigger problem.

Buckled or Warped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age or a more serious issue. Our team can assess the damage and provide a solution to get your floors back to normal.

Visible Signs of Leaks

Water droplets, puddles, or evidence of recent flooding can show a leak or water damage. Don’t wait, call us to address the issue before it’s too late.

Unexplained Mold Growth

Mold can grow rapidly in damp environments. If you notice mold or mildew in your home,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age and health risks.

Unusual Sounds or Creaks

Unusual sounds or creaks can show a more serious issue, such as a leak or structural damage. Don’t ignore these warning signs, call us to assess the situation.

Window Leak Water Removal Cost in Rockwall, TX

The cost of Window Leak Water Removal in Rockwall, TX, var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here’s a general estimate of what you might expect to pay: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, amount of water, and equipment needed
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, amount of moisture, and equipment needed
Repair and Restoration $2,000 – $10,000 Size of affected area, materials needed, and labor required
Final Inspection and Cleanup $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, equipment needed, and labor required
Emergency Response (24/7) $1,000 – $5,000 Time of day, severity of damage, and equipment needed

Keep in mind that these estimates are rough and may vary based on your specific situation. Our team will provide a detailed, personalized quote after assessing your property.

What’s the difference between water extraction and drying?

Water extraction removes standing water, while drying and dehumidification remove excess moisture from the air and surfaces. Both steps are crucial in preventing further damage and health risks.
